Tension is bad. Really, really bad. When we’re tense, we’re not as easygoing, not as carefree, not as willing to laugh at a corny joke, or give our spouse the benefit of the doubt.
While any number of things can cause the tension, there’s one surefire way to help relieve it: busting out the lotions and body oils and getting a serious head-to-toe rubdown. If done properly, the recipient will be thankful that you took the time to help them relieve the pent-up stress they’ve been caring around in their back, shoulder, legs, and feet.
Some suggestions:
- Make a Pandora radio station of their favorite artist. Have it playing in the background while you give the massage.
- Aim for at least 25 minutes. This seems like a very long time, but that’s precisely the point. Spend him touching your spouse in a way that’s merely relaxing, not necessarily leading to sex.
- Watch a couple YouTube videos to get some tips on massage techniques for particular areas of the body – shoulders, head, feet, arms, legs.
